Singapore's Most Stylish Women 2016: Karen Ong-Tan
The statuesque former lawyer is a fashion chameleon, constantly sporting new and eclectic styles
This year’s diverse crop of extraordinary women in Singapore have it all: Sophistication, smarts and an exceptional sartorial sensibility that put them in a league of their own. Even though she describes herself as a creature of habit, the statuesque former lawyer is a fashion chameleon, constantly sporting new and eclectic styles. But whenever she has a power suit on, you know she means business.

Tell us some of your favourite brands.
I love being introduced to new brands and I’m open to trying out what they have to offer… I enjoy eponymous and self-owned brands such as Antonio Berardi, Delpozo, Roksanda Ilincic, Rosie Assoulin and Toni Matičevski because I feel that there is a clearer sense of execution of the designer’s and brand’s vision. These brands also tend to create pieces that are feminine and yet have distinct and striking silhouettes. I also have a growing appreciation for Singaporean and Asian designers—Koonhor’s one of my favourites.
